MySQL は、オープンソースであり、高度な信頼性、安定性、柔軟性を備えた人気のリレーショナル データベース管理システムです。 Web アプリケーションのデータ ストレージに使用でき、データ分析やデータ マイニングなどの大規模なデータ処理にも対応できます。
MySQL を使用する前に、まず MySQL をインストールし、次に MySQL で最初のデータベースを作成する必要があります。以下は、新しい MySQL データベースを作成する方法を示す簡単なガイドです。
ステップ 1: MySQL をインストールする
MySQL をコンピュータにインストールするには、まず MySQL 公式 Web サイト www.mysql.com からオペレーティング システムのインストール プログラムをダウンロードし、プロンプトの手順に従う必要があります。ステップごとにインストールします。
ステップ 2: MySQL の起動
MySQL をインストールした後、データベースを作成できるように MySQL を起動する必要があります。コントロール パネルで MySQL サービスを見つけることができます。MySQL がサービスとしてインストールされていない場合は、コンソールで MySQL フォルダーを開き、bin サブディレクトリで mysql.exe を見つけます (Win7 は通常、C:\Program Files\MySQL\MySQL にあります) Server 5.6 \bin) を選択して実行すると、コマンドは次のようになります。
mysql -u root -p
-u はログインする MySQL アカウントを指定します。root は最高の権限を持つアカウントです。-p は、ログインすることを意味します。ログインを確認するにはパスワードを入力する必要があります。
ステップ 3: 新しい MySQL データベースを作成する
データベース管理システムに正常にログインしたら、MySQL に最初のデータベースを作成できます。以下は、mydatabase という名前のデータベースを作成するサンプル コードです。
create database mydatabase;
このコマンドは、mydatabase という名前の新しいデータベースを作成します。ここで、この新しいデータベースを使用することを MySQL に伝える必要があります。コマンドは次のとおりです。
use mydatabase;
ステップ 4: テーブルの作成
新しい MySQL データベースを作成したので、データを保存するためにテーブルをいくつか追加する必要があります。テーブルはデータベース内の最も基本的なデータ単位であり、Excel のテーブルと考えることができます。
次は、id、ユーザー名、パスワードの 3 つのフィールドを含むユーザー テーブルを作成するサンプル コードです。
CREATE TABLE user( id INT NOT NULL AUTO_INCREMENT PRIMARY KEY, username VARCHAR(50) NOT NULL, password VARCHAR(50) NOT NULL);
このコードは、id、ユーザー名という 3 つのフィールドを含む user という名前のテーブルを作成します。そしてパスワード。このうち、idフィールドは主キーとして設定されており、自動採番は空ではありません(NOT NULL)。
これで、MySQL データベースが正常に作成され、そこにテーブルが追加されました。上記のコマンドを使用して、他のテーブルの作成、テーブルの変更、テーブルの削除を行うことができます。 MySQL は、インデックス、トランザクション、ストアド プロシージャなど、多くの高度な機能を提供します。より高度なデータベース機能を使用したい場合は、MySQL 公式マニュアルを参照してください。
概要:
- MySQL のインストール
- MySQL サービスの開始
- MySQL へのログイン
- 新しい MySQL データベースの作成
- 新しいテーブルを作成します
以上が新しい MySQL データベースを作成する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

MySQLデータベースをアップグレードする手順には次のものがあります。1。データベースをバックアップします。2。現在のMySQLサービスを停止します。3。MySQLの新しいバージョンをインストールします。アップグレードプロセス中に互換性の問題が必要であり、Perconatoolkitなどの高度なツールをテストと最適化に使用できます。

MySQLバックアップポリシーには、論理バックアップ、物理バックアップ、増分バックアップ、レプリケーションベースのバックアップ、クラウドバックアップが含まれます。 1. Logical BackupはMySqldumpを使用してデータベースの構造とデータをエクスポートします。これは、小さなデータベースとバージョンの移行に適しています。 2.物理バックアップは、データファイルをコピーすることで高速かつ包括的ですが、データベースの一貫性が必要です。 3.インクリメンタルバックアップは、バイナリロギングを使用して変更を記録します。これは、大規模なデータベースに適しています。 4.レプリケーションベースのバックアップは、サーバーからバックアップすることにより、生産システムへの影響を減らします。 5. Amazonrdsなどのクラウドバックアップは自動化ソリューションを提供しますが、コストと制御を考慮する必要があります。ポリシーを選択するときは、データベースサイズ、ダウンタイム許容度、回復時間、および回復ポイントの目標を考慮する必要があります。

mysqlclusteringenhancesdatabaserobustnessnessnessnessnessnistandistributiondistributingdataacrossmultiplenodes.itesthendbenginefordatareplication andfaulttolerance、保証highavailability.setupinvolvesconfiguringmanagement、data、ssqlnodes、carefulmonitoringringandpe

MySQLのデータベーススキーマ設計の最適化は、次の手順を通じてパフォーマンスを改善できます。1。インデックス最適化:一般的なクエリ列にインデックスを作成し、クエリのオーバーヘッドのバランスをとり、更新を挿入します。 2。テーブル構造の最適化:正規化または反通常化によりデータ冗長性を削減し、アクセス効率を改善します。 3。データ型の選択:Varcharの代わりにINTなどの適切なデータ型を使用して、ストレージスペースを削減します。 4。パーティション化とサブテーブル:大量のデータボリュームの場合、パーティション化とサブテーブルを使用してデータを分散させてクエリとメンテナンスの効率を改善します。

tooptimizemysqlperformance、soflowthesesteps:1)properindexingtospeedupqueries、2)useexplaintoanalyzeandoptimize Queryperformance、3)AductServerContingSettingStingsinginginnodb_buffer_pool_sizeandmax_connections、4)

MySQL関数は、データ処理と計算に使用できます。 1.基本的な使用には、文字列処理、日付計算、数学操作が含まれます。 2。高度な使用法には、複数の関数を組み合わせて複雑な操作を実装することが含まれます。 3.パフォーマンスの最適化では、Where句での機能の使用を回避し、GroupByおよび一時テーブルを使用する必要があります。

MySQLでデータを挿入するための効率的な方法には、次のものが含まれます。1。insertInto ...値構文、2。LoadDatainFileコマンドの使用、3。トランザクション処理の使用、4。バッチサイズの調整、5。Insurtignoreまたは挿入の使用...

MySQLでは、AlterTabletable_nameaddcolumnnew_columnvarchar(255)afterexisting_columnを使用してフィールドを追加し、andtabletable_namedopcolumncolumn_to_dropを使用してフィールドを削除します。フィールドを追加するときは、クエリのパフォーマンスとデータ構造を最適化する場所を指定する必要があります。フィールドを削除する前に、操作が不可逆的であることを確認する必要があります。オンラインDDL、バックアップデータ、テスト環境、および低負荷期間を使用したテーブル構造の変更は、パフォーマンスの最適化とベストプラクティスです。


ホットAIツール

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。

Undress AI Tool
脱衣画像を無料で

Clothoff.io
AI衣類リムーバー

Video Face Swap
完全無料の AI 顔交換ツールを使用して、あらゆるビデオの顔を簡単に交換できます。

人気の記事

ホットツール

DVWA
Damn Vulnerable Web App (DVWA) は、非常に脆弱な PHP/MySQL Web アプリケーションです。その主な目的は、セキュリティ専門家が法的環境でスキルとツールをテストするのに役立ち、Web 開発者が Web アプリケーションを保護するプロセスをより深く理解できるようにし、教師/生徒が教室環境で Web アプリケーションを教え/学習できるようにすることです。安全。 DVWA の目標は、シンプルでわかりやすいインターフェイスを通じて、さまざまな難易度で最も一般的な Web 脆弱性のいくつかを実践することです。このソフトウェアは、

VSCode Windows 64 ビットのダウンロード
Microsoft によって発売された無料で強力な IDE エディター

SublimeText3 中国語版
中国語版、とても使いやすい

SecLists
SecLists は、セキュリティ テスターの究極の相棒です。これは、セキュリティ評価中に頻繁に使用されるさまざまな種類のリストを 1 か所にまとめたものです。 SecLists は、セキュリティ テスターが必要とする可能性のあるすべてのリストを便利に提供することで、セキュリティ テストをより効率的かつ生産的にするのに役立ちます。リストの種類には、ユーザー名、パスワード、URL、ファジング ペイロード、機密データ パターン、Web シェルなどが含まれます。テスターはこのリポジトリを新しいテスト マシンにプルするだけで、必要なあらゆる種類のリストにアクセスできるようになります。

mPDF
mPDF は、UTF-8 でエンコードされた HTML から PDF ファイルを生成できる PHP ライブラリです。オリジナルの作者である Ian Back は、Web サイトから「オンザフライ」で PDF ファイルを出力し、さまざまな言語を処理するために mPDF を作成しました。 HTML2FPDF などのオリジナルのスクリプトよりも遅く、Unicode フォントを使用すると生成されるファイルが大きくなりますが、CSS スタイルなどをサポートし、多くの機能強化が施されています。 RTL (アラビア語とヘブライ語) や CJK (中国語、日本語、韓国語) を含むほぼすべての言語をサポートします。ネストされたブロックレベル要素 (P、DIV など) をサポートします。

ホットトピック









